What is IDX Bren Saham?

First things first, let's define what IDX Bren Saham actually refers to. IDX stands for Indonesia Stock Exchange, which is where companies list their shares for public trading. Bren is the ticker symbol for PT Barito Renewables Energy Tbk, a company focusing on renewable energy. Therefore, IDX Bren Saham simply means the shares of PT Barito Renewables Energy Tbk traded on the Indonesia Stock Exchange.

PT Barito Renewables Energy Tbk, under the ticker symbol BREN, is a key player in Indonesia's burgeoning renewable energy sector. The company focuses on harnessing geothermal energy, a clean and sustainable power source derived from the Earth's internal heat. In a world increasingly concerned about climate change and the need to transition away from fossil fuels, BREN's activities are not only environmentally significant but also economically promising. The company's operations involve exploring, developing, and operating geothermal power plants across Indonesia, a country rich in geothermal resources due to its location along the Ring of Fire. These power plants convert the Earth's heat into electricity, which is then supplied to the national grid, contributing to the country's energy mix and reducing reliance on traditional fossil fuels. This makes BREN an important contributor to Indonesia's energy transition goals and its commitment to reducing carbon emissions. Factors Influencing IDX Bren Saham's Price

Like any stock, IDX Bren Saham's price is influenced by a variety of factors. Understanding these factors can help you make more informed investment decisions:

  • Global Energy Prices: Fluctuations in global energy prices, particularly oil and gas, can impact the perceived value of renewable energy companies like BREN. Higher fossil fuel prices can make renewable energy more competitive and attractive to investors.
  • Government Regulations: Changes in government regulations related to renewable energy, such as subsidies, tax incentives, or mandates, can significantly affect BREN's profitability and growth prospects.
  • Company Performance: BREN's financial results, project developments, and operational efficiency directly impact investor confidence and stock price. Positive news tends to drive the price up, while negative news can have the opposite effect.
  • Market Sentiment: Overall market sentiment and investor risk appetite can influence stock prices across the board, including BREN. In a bull market, investors are more willing to take risks, driving up stock prices, while in a bear market, they tend to be more cautious.
  • Competition: The competitive landscape in the renewable energy sector can also affect BREN's stock price. Increased competition can put pressure on profit margins and growth potential.
